    and the spec's.
    team losi XXXT kit. bought back in 2001.
    trinity speed gems 2 15X4 motor (in a speed gems 2 12X2 can and 17X1 end bell)
    duratrax streak esc.
    cheapo servo
    HPI radio
    team losi wheels
    proline dirt works tires

    hop up's:
    trinity "team kinwald" aluminum rear pivot block
    trinity "team kinwald" aluminum front hinge pin brace
    losi graphite rear suspension arms
    losi graphite rear chassis plate
    AE ball studs (off a T3)
    AE turnbuckles (off a T3)
    HG titanium top shaft
